ICP Association Supports Paving Project for Hound© Medical Center


Banwa: The association of Head Nurses of the post (ICP) of the Hound© health district made a contribution of 210,000 FCFA on Thursday, June 18, 2026, and participated in the making of paving stones as part of the paving operation of the Medical Center with surgical unit (CMA) of Hound©.



According to Burkina Information Agency, Adama Zan, coordinator of the association of Head Nurses of Posts (ICP) of the Hound© health district, stated that this contribution aims to mark their support for the initiative of the High Commissioner of the province for the paving of the CMA.



Comrade Zan indicated that the ICPs are among the primary stakeholders in this project. He emphasized that they did not want to remain on the sidelines and called upon the established bodies and all active forces in the province to mobilize around this initiative.



‘The CMA is a shared home. It is a referral health center for the 45 health facilities in the province,’ he asserted. The ICPs also pledged to return, individually or collectively, to continue their participation in the work.



The High Commissioner of the province of Tuy, Issiaka Segda, recalled the importance of the initiative before thanking the ICP for their contribution.
